Barn
She hit a boy
with a shovel
in a barn. She
saw nothing
but the math
of it. Ascent,
arc, intersect.
And the shapes:
triangle on oval
in a sun-drowned
pentagon.
A thing in motion
tends to stay. She
hit a boy. She
grew up to list
numbers in files
in pale rooms
full of dustless
air. She wears
nice clothes.
She wears
nice clothes.
-- Rachel Contreni Flynn
